Gaining Free Legal Advice: Your Right to Representation
Navigating the legal system can be challenging, especially when facing unfamiliar cases. Fortunately, many jurisdictions offer access to free legal advice and representation for individuals whom meet certain requirements. Understanding your rights in this matter is crucial.
- Seek legal aid organizations or pro bono services in your area. These entities often offer guidance on a wide range of judicial matters.
- Be aware that free legal advice is typically confined to specific concerns. For more extensive cases, you may need additional legal counsel.
- Document all relevant information pertaining to your case. This can help legal professionals assess your stance more effectively.
Public Interest Litigation: Championing Social Justice
Public interest litigation acts as a crucial instrument for safeguarding fundamental rights and promoting social justice. Through this innovative legal approach, individuals or organizations can initiate lawsuits on behalf of the general good, addressing issues that may otherwise be overlooked.
Public interest litigation empowers marginalized groups to vindicate their rights, ensuring that justice prevails for all. This vital legal strategy has proven effective in addressing a wide range of civic issues, from access to education.
By championing the interests of the public, public interest litigation upholds the rule of law and contributes to a more fair society.
